For instance, Fess Parker (1924-2010) was named a Disney Legend in 1991 and was honored with his own window in Frontierland at Disneyland. Walt discovered Fess in the movie “Them†and asked him to stop by the studio; Fess brought his guitar, met Walt, sang a song, and said goodbye. Walt cast him as Davy Crockett, and he went on to star in many other Disney productions – but will always be remembered for his coonskin cap.Seating is limited. Tenderloin SlidersMakes 12Caramelized Onion-Horseradish Aioli1 white onion, peeled, halved and thinly sliced3 tablespoons olive oilSalt and Pepper to taste1 cup mayonnaise2 tablespoons prepared horseradishCoarse salt and freshly ground black pepper, to tasteTenderloin Sliders1 (2-pound) beef tenderloinCoarse salt, to taste3 tablespoons light olive oil, divided12 slider buns, halved1 cup Caramelized Onion-Horseradish Aïoli2 tablespoons micro basil or finely chopped basilFor caramelized onion horseradish aioli:Add oil to a heavy bottom sauté pan over medium-high heat until oil shimmers. Add onions to hot oil, stirring to coat. Add a pinch of salt.Cook, stirring often, until onions are golden, tender, and dark brown in spots. Set aside.Combine mayonnaise, horseradish, and 1/2 cup caramelized onions in the work bowl of a food processor; process until fully combined.Season with salt and pepper to taste.For tenderloin sliders:Bring tenderloin to room temperature 1 hour before cooking. Season beef tenderloin generously with salt and pepper. Preheat oven to 475°F.Heat 2 tablespoons oil in a large, ovenproof skillet over high heat. Sear tenderloin on all sides until outside is well browned, about 10 to 12 minutes total.Transfer beef on skillet to oven and roast until center reaches 120°F for rare or 125°F for medium-rare, about 18 to 25 minutes. Let beef rest at room temperature at least 15 minutes before slicing.Cut tenderloin into 1 ½-inch thick slices.To toast buns, heat remaining 1 tablespoon in a large sauté pan over medium heat. Place buns, cut side down, into pan and toast until light golden brown.Place 1 slice tenderloin on the bottom half of each bun; top with a dollop of Caramelized Onion-Horseradish Aïoli and sprinkle with micro basil or chopped basil.
